Understanding e-Recruitment and Its Evolution

Exploring the Evolution of Online Recruitment

The advent of online recruitment has significantly reshaped the hiring landscape. Once reliant on traditional methods like newspaper job advertisements and word of mouth, recruitment has evolved into a dynamic process enriched by digital tools and platforms. Today's recruitment systems are rooted in software that enables companies to manage job postings, potential candidates, and the overall hiring process. Through platforms that include job boards and social media, organizations can cast a wider net to attract and evaluate applicants efficiently, ultimately optimizing the applicant management journey. Online recruitment leverages recruitment software to make the job of tracking, evaluating, and engaging with candidates a streamlined activity. Applicant tracking systems (ATS) have become essential in organizing candidate data, minimizing administrative tasks, and improving the recruitment process by saving time and resources. An important aspect of this digital transformation is the emergence of management systems that provide hiring teams with tools for analyzing applications, conducting interviews online, and managing job openings more effectively. These changes in the recruitment process enhance the employer brand by presenting a modern and efficient hiring environment to prospective candidates. The evolution does not stop there. As the recruitment landscape continues to change, integrating trends such as AI-driven tools will further remodel the processes for both employers and candidates. Ethical Considerations in AI-Powered Recruitment

Ethical Dimensions of Implementing AI in Recruitment

With the surge in artificial intelligence integration within recruitment systems, companies are increasingly encountering complex ethical dilemmas. As businesses strive to create more efficient hiring processes utilizing AI-driven tools, maintaining ethical standards and fairness becomes paramount.

One significant concern is the potential for bias in recruitment software and algorithms. While AI has the capability to streamline the hiring process, it can also inadvertently replicate or even exacerbate existing biases present in the data it analyzes. This might result in unfair treatment of diverse candidates, raising questions about diversity and inclusion within applicant management. It is crucial for companies to diligently audit their recruiting software and tracking systems to identify and mitigate such biases.

Additionally, protecting the data privacy of applicants remains a pressing issue. As platforms and applications handle vast amounts of personal information, ensuring robust data protection measures are in place is vital. Companies must adhere to stringent legal and ethical guidelines to secure candidate data, thereby fostering trust in their applicant management systems.

Transparency in the recruitment process is another cornerstone of ethical recruitment practices. Clarifying the role AI plays in decision-making and providing candidates with insights into how their applications are processed can enhance the candidate experience. This transparency helps in building a strong employer brand and reassures potential candidates about the fairness of job postings and job advertisements they are applying to.

Lastly, the management system must prioritize accountability. Implementing AI in recruitment should not lead to absolving human recruiters of responsibility. Continuous oversight is essential to maintain the integrity of the hiring process and ensure that recruitment decisions, influenced by AI tools, align with the company’s values and ethical standards.

The intersection of AI and ethics within recruitment remains a fluid landscape, where evolving practices and technologies constantly challenge existing norms. By remaining vigilant and adaptable, companies can successfully navigate these ethical considerations, leveraging AI to create more equitable recruiting outcomes.
